کاربران حرفهای کامپیوترهای مک میدانند که برای مشاهده محتوای داخل یک دایرکتوری خاص در ترمینال، باید از دستور خطر ls استفاده کنند.
به طور کل این دستور در تمامی سیستم عاملهای مبتنی بر یونیکس و شبه یونیکس کاربرد دارد و کاربران میتوانند از آن برای فراخوانی محتوای داخلی یک دایرکتوری در مک او اس، لینوکس و BSD استفاده کنند. دستور ls تمامی محتویات داخل یک دایرکتوری را به صورت متنی لیست کرده و آنها را به شما نشان میدهد. در عین حال شما میتوانید با استفاده از این پسوندهای مختلف، روش نمایش اطلاعات این دستور را تغییر داده تا موارد حاضر در دایرکتوری مورد نظر شما با ترتیب خاصی به شما نشان داده شود.
از آنجایی که این مجموعه به صورت متنی محتویات تصویری را نشان میدهد، ممکن است پیدا کردن یک فایل مشخص در یک دایرکتوری پر از محتوای، مختلف کار دشواری باشد. به همین دلیل، استفاده از قابلیت مرتب کردن فایلها بر اساس موارد گوناگون به کاربران اجازه میدهد تا با سرعت بیشتری فایل مورد نظر خود را پیدا کنند.
مرتب کردن لیست فایلها با دستور ls در ترمینال
روش انجام این کار بسیار آسان است و تنها کافی است، از پسوندهای مختلف در دستور ls استفاده کنید. در حقیقت پسوندهای مختلف که پس از کاراکتر خط تیره در دستور متنی قرار میگیرند، اجرای آن دستور را مشخص میکنند.
- 1.ترمینال را باز کنید
- 2.دستور زیر را برای ترتیب محتویات داخل یک دایرکتوری بر اساس تاریخ وارد کنید:
ls –lt
شما همچنین میتوانید با استفاده از دستور متنی زیر ترتیب محتوای داخل یک دایرکتوری را علاوه بر تاریخ، با توجه به حجم آنها مرتب کنید:
ls –halt
برای برعکس کردن ترتیب لیست نیز میتوانید از دستور زیر استفاده کنید تا از موارد مختلف از اول تا آخر مرتب شود. پسوند r در دستور مبتنی فوق باعث میشود تا ترتیب یاد شده از اول به آخر مرتب شود.
ls –haltr